D.CONDENSATE RETURN LINES

(8)For electric humidifiers (NHTC & NHPC only) using a small size blower pack (<30 lbs/hr), steam lines require 7/8” O.D. (Nominal ¾”) copper tubing. For steam runs longer than 20 ft, use insulated nominal 1” copper to ensure draining of condensate.

(9)When using the GS, SE, or NHRS Humidifiers with a RO / DI water supply, all steam lines should be in stainless steel.

(10)Do not use plastic pipe for steam distribution or hose other than NORTEC supplied. Substitution will void warranty.

(11)If steam line is routed below the blower pack, or if the blower pack is lower than the humidifier, a condensate trap “tee” will be required to remove water at this low point. Run the condensate from the trap to the nearest drain lower than the blower pack. See Figure 5 Condensate Removal.

(12)Do not run the steam line more than 1 foot per lb/hr output. Example, 10 lbs/hr should not have a steam run longer than 10 feet. If long runs are unavoidable, the humidifier should be sized larger to compensate for condensate losses and insulated stainless steel or copper must be used.

D.CONDENSATE RETURN LINES

(1)NORTEC blower packs have built-in connections for draining off condensate. These condensate lines must be connected to the nearest floor drain, back to the unit (NHTC & NHPC, NHRS only) or a condensate pump when using short condensate runs.

(2)Always incorporate a trap in routing of condensate return lines. Condensate that accumulates in trap will prevent possibility of steam escaping. Depth of the trap must be equal or more than 3” (76 mm) See Figure 6 Condensate Return Line Trap.

(3)Ensure the trap is at least 3 feet (1 m) below the blower pack and as close to the floor drain as possible.

E.PRIMARY VOLTAGE CONNECTION

(1)All blower packs for SE and GS unit are wired by others to be powered by an independent circuit. Follow all codes.

(2)A control thermostat, mounted on the blower pack, automatically starts the fans when steam is detected.

(3)NH Series remote mounted blower packs wired to a humidifier or independent circuit require field wiring between two primary voltage terminal blocks and two low voltage control (class 1 circuit wiring required) terminal strips; one of each located in humidifier and remote blower pack cabinet. Knock-outs are provided on the humidifier to facilitate this. To connect the primary and control (class 1 circuit wiring required) wiring, the wiring is fed through the grommet provided in the bottom of the blower pack.

(4)Field wiring of remote blower packs must conform to national and local electrical codes. Refer to wiring diagram supplied at the back of this manual (See page 9).
